Speedy Recovery After Cosmetic Surgery

The cosmetic surgery recovery totally depends upon the extension and intensity of the operations.

Mostly for face operations the sutures are kept for 5-10 days and a tube is inserted for drainage, which is removed after a day or two of the surgery.
Mostly people can resume work after 2-3 weeks time if there are no complications or side effects. For speedy recovery, it is very important for the families to take best care of the patient after cosmetic surgery. Postoperative care and proper precautions is a must to resume normal life soon.
Post Operative Precautions And Options After Cosmetic Surgery
Cosmetic surgery may sound very exciting and people can take the decision of surgery without proper knowledge. It is advisable to take a list of precautions from the doctor before the surgery is done. Few precautions that Cosmo Surgeons and doctors suggest are:

  • Take prescribed pain killers a few days after the surgery very carefully
  • Diet should be as prescribed by the doctor, mostly in facial surgery there is difficulty in having food
  • Apply antibiotic and ointment as prescribed by the doctor after the sutures are removed
  • Exposure to sun should be minimum
  • Don’t apply any cosmetic in the region as it can lead to infection or allergy
  • Keep your skin clean, wash the area with medicated water or as instructed by the doctor
  • Don’t exert yourself or try to speed up your plastic surgery recovery, let it heal in its own time
  • No alcohol or smoke should be taken till the operated area recovers completely
  • Keep in touch with the doctor and inform him if you see abnormality
  • Don’t treat yourself at any time, always ask your doctors advice
How To Hide Scars Using Camouflage Cosmetics
After facial surgery it may take weeks or months to be normal, like any other surgery plastic surgery too leaves scars and at times one needs to hide it, it is not possible to stay indoors and wait for them to heal completely. There are few options available that can to great extent hide your scars and marks. They are Concealers, curative & camouflage creams, foundations, powders, and makeup removers.

Choose the foundations and creams that match your skin color closest, these base makes your face look more even and smooth. With time you will pick up effective camouflage make up tricks that you can master only by practice.

Always remember that post plastic surgery you need to select your makeup products carefully. They should be high in quality and you should not be allergic to them.
